The four-star lineman from Chandler, Arizona, switched his commitment to Auburn today. Westerman cited his close relationship to Tigers o-line coach Jeff Grimes, as well as McWhorter’s recent departure, as the reasons for his decision. Remember, Texas tried unsuccessfully to lure Grimes away from The Plains earlier this week. Brown ultimately hired Georgia offensive line coach, Stacy Searels.
There’s not much of a chance that Westerman will rescind on his new commitment, but his decision is for now a verbal, non-binding one. National Signing Day is in less than two weeks away, on Feb. 2.
